stevkrause 1,247 Report post Posted August 11, 2010 Tier 1 games: Any out of conference, original 6 teams are always good calls, just because the new format doesn't bring them into Detroit every year and the air is always electric for these match-ups (Canadians, Bruins, Rangers, Maple Leafs) Tier 2 games: Eastern conference, competitive teams - same reason as far as them not coming to Detroit every year, so it's always a little more pumped up, there's just not as much history, but can be just as good of, OR BETTER, games to watch(Washington, Philadelphia, Pittsburgh, Tier 3: Games with a vested interest - Tampa(obvious reasons), Anaheim, Nashville, San Jose, Chicago(bad blood) Tier 4: Every other game, because at the end of the day... it's still the Wings!
